Key highlights

  • Dynamic Calibration: The hCage's integrated dynamic calibrator ensures precise and consistent magnetic field measurements, eliminating the need for manual calibration
  • Bi-Polar Control: Achieve precise magnetic field control in three axes with a ±0.5 µT resolution, enabling you to simulate a wide range of magnetic environments.
  • High Field Strength: Generate magnetic fields up to 180 µT, accommodating a variety of space mission requirements.
  • Unified Software Interface: The intuitive software interface simplifies setup, operation, and calibration, streamlining your workflow.
  • Robust Construction: The hCage's anodized aluminum frame provides durability and reliability in demanding space environments.
  • Versatile Mounting Options: Easily integrate the hCage into your CubeSat design with a range of mounting options to suit different configurations
